In the midst of a difficult start for Fiorentina in Serie A, Argentine midfielder Franco Mastantuono met one of the greatest idols in the club's history: Gabriel Batistuta. The two compatriots took a photo together and shared it on their social media, a gesture that the young player interpreted as strong support during a delicate moment.
Mastantuono joined the Viola in this transfer window, on loan from Real Madrid, and since his arrival, he has yet to make a significant impact. The Florentine team lost its first two matches of the tournament by large margins: 4-0 against Roma and 3-0 against Frosinone. In both matches, the former River Plate player was a starter, but he was unable to influence the game enough for his team to earn at least one point.
The photo with Batistuta comes in this context. The historic forward, who wore the violet jersey in 331 matches and scored 203 goals, has become an absolute reference for the club. For a young player still trying to adapt to Italian football, receiving support from Bati represents an important message of confidence.
The midfielder had revealed a few days ago some details about his departure from Real Madrid and why he chose Fiorentina. According to him, the club's project impressed him greatly, and he decided to bet on a place where he could have continuity and grow. However, the team's start has not yet provided the ideal scenario for him to showcase his talents.
